Roshan Sunthar

updated on 28-02-2023


Canada vs India

Canada vs India

Canada vs India - which is better? Before concluding, let’s review the facts. Every year, many Indians move to Canada for study, work or migration purposes despite an expensive visa. As per the IRCC Report 2022, Indians contribute 32% of permanent residents admitted. Nevertheless, comparing the standard of living, education, jobs, etc., between India and Canada can help you make an informed decision. So, let’s discuss these factors in detail. 

Benefits of Living in Canada

Following is the list of benefits of living in Canada. While moving abroad, keep these factors in mind.

  • High Standard of Living - Canada has a high standard of living, ensuring basic needs, like drinking water, clean air, etc. They offer corrupt-free services to all.
  • Quality Education - Education is free for children up to 16 - 18 years. For higher education, Canadian universities are among the top 30 in QS World University Rankings and attract millions of international students. 
  • Free Healthcare System - Since Canada has the best healthcare infrastructure facilities and medical insurance, it guarantees a free healthcare system. 
  • Safety and Security - Canada is a peaceful country where people of different races and ethnicity are easy to go along with. There is a low crime rate and social stability. 
  • Cultural Diversity - Canada is built by people from different parts of the world. So, they always embrace different cultures and ethnicities.
  • Huge Job Market - Top companies, like Google, KPMG, IBM, and online job portals are available for freshers. So it’s easy to get a job in Canada right after graduation.  
  • Low Living Cost - Compared to other English-speaking countries, Canada has a low cost of living, which includes rent, public transportation, accessories, groceries, etc.
  • Tourism - Canada features a diverse landscape used exclusively for tourism. Niagara falls, Old Quebec, and Whistler are some of the famous tourist destinations. 
  • Social and Political Stability - Canadian government provides political and social stability. There is no political turmoil, strikes, processions or outbursts seen.
  • Welcoming Immigrants - To fill the employment gap, Canada attracts skilled migrants across the globe. In 2022, Canada welcomed 431,645 new permanent residents (PRs). 

Benefits of Living in India

If you’re wondering how good India is, compared to other countries, check out the following list of the benefits of living in India.


  • Low Cost of Living - Despite being the 6th largest economy, India’s cost of living is low, unlike other countries like the US, China, Japan, etc.
  • Favourable Climate - India is best for its favourable climate, and accommodating people across the world. Almost 90% of the Indian landmass is suitable for living. 
  • Tourist Attractions - India features some of the world’s famous attractions like the Taj Mahal, the Himalayas, etc. Tourists visit India for ancient monuments, spirituality, healthcare, adventure, and serene natural spots. 
  • Good Education System - In India, education is a fundamental right, free for children up to 14 years of age. For higher education, universities are striving to achieve international standards. However, they offer skilled labourers.
  • Quality Food - India is blessed with a variety of natural resources. That’s why they produce good quality food. They follow age-old cooking to ensure it’s healthy.  
  • Traditional Festivals - Due to its diverse and rich culture, Indians give importance to traditional festivals and celebrate them every year.
  • Welcome Culture - India is fond of foreigners, and they welcome them with joy. Since India has tourist places everywhere, they know how to treat people from abroad and make them feel good and comfortable.
  • HealthCare and Insurance - India is booming in the healthcare industry. Recently, they've been equipped with the latest technology necessary for treatment. Citizens have become cautious about health, taking medical insurance just in case. 

1. Canada vs India: Standard of Living

The standard of living is measured based on a person’s material wealth. If there are high employment opportunities and high income, there is a high standard of living. Since an individual (skilled/unskilled) finds a job easier in Canada than in India with a high income, Canada is to have a high standard of living. In the latest Human Development Index (HDI) report, Canada is 15th, and India is in the 132nd position based on three critical factors.

In Canada, the average earring of a skilled worker is $75,000 per year. Whereas in India, the average salary is INR 3,50,000 per year or ₹30,000 per month (488.40 CAD). It shows that Canadians have more purchasing power. In fact, Canada is among the top 10 countries that provide the best quality of life, ensuring employees’ work-life balance.

2. Canada vs India: Education System

Canada and India provide free education to children from 6 to 14 years (some Canadian provinces offer up to 16 - 18 years). In terms of quality education, Canada surpasses India. The education system in Canada comprises kindergarten, public & private schools, and universities. Here, private schools charge CAD 6,000 - 26,000 per year. But, the government gives subsidies in the tuition fee and scholarships in Canada for Indian students

When it comes to tertiary institutions, Canada has some of the best. In the 2023 QS World University Rankings, Canadian universities are among the top 50s, like McGill University in 31st, the University of Toronto in 34th, and the University of British Columbia in 47th position. On the other hand, Indian universities are among the top 200s. For example, the Indian Institute of Science is 155th, IIT Bombay is 172nd, and IIT Delhi is in 174th position.

Because of this, many Indians study abroad in Canada for bachelor’s & master’s degrees, with the eligibility criteria like IELTS/TOEFL/PTE scores, fee structure, credits, etc. They mostly choose Medicine, IT, Law, or MBA programs. Meanwhile, Canada offers SDS and Non-SDS visas for international students to gain visas swiftly. And after graduation, students can apply for PR, provided the requirements are met.

3. Canada vs India: Cost of Living

The term “cost of living” means the money required to meet basic needs like housing, food, transportation, healthcare, etc. Since the value of a Canadian dollar is 61.42 Indian rupee, it’s obvious that Canada has a higher cost of living compared to India. For a better understanding, the cost of living in India vs Canada is given below.

The Average Cost of Living in India vs Canada
Factors Canada India
Accommodation 1,500 - 3,000 CAD per month INR 5,000 - 15,000 per month
Food expenses 150 - 250 CAD per month INR 500 - 2000 per week
Utility costs 300 CAD per month INR 8,000 per month
Transportation 80 - 150 CAD per month INR 1,000 - 3,000 per month
Health & Medicine $550 CAD per month ₹2,000 per month
Education (Tuition Fee) $15,000 - $23,000 per year ₹2 - 5 Lakh per year
Miscellaneous 200 CAD per month INR 1000 per month

From the above information, it’s obvious that:

  • Food prices are 502.67% higher in Canada than in India
  • House rent prices are 750.90% higher in Canada than in India
  • Healthcare prices are 28 times higher in Canada than in India
  • Transportation prices are 100.23% higher in Canada than in India
  • Education costs are 143.20% higher in Canada than in India

However, the monthly income, purchasing power and living standards are better in Canada. 

4. Canada vs India: Employment Opportunities

Without any second thought, Canada offers better employment opportunities than India. The job market in Canada for international students is one step ahead of other English-speaking countries due to co-op facilities for students, high-salaried jobs, work-life balance and a hybrid working model. Also, there are various avenues available to easily get a job, like Talent Egg, Job Fairs, networking events, and online portals.

The average salary in Canada is between CAD 55,000 and CAD 107,000 annually, while in India, the average salary for skilled labourers is between 4 lakhs to 15 lakhs per annum. Some key employee benefits in Canada include vacation leave, pension contributions, employment insurance, paid time off and survivor benefits for those who’ve passed away.

Check out the top paying jobs in Canada vs India in the table below.

Top Paying Jobs in Canada vs India
Canada India
Cloud Architects Medical Doctors
IT Project Manager Marketing Manager
Data Scientists Blockchain Developer
Full-Stack Developers Product Management
DevOps Engineers Chartered Accountant
Business Intelligence Analysts Investment Banker
AI and Machine Learning Expert Full Stack Software Developer
Cloud Systems Engineers Machine Learning Professionals
Digital Marketers Management Consultants
Cyber-Security Officers Commercial Pilots

Other than the above information, there are also other highest paying jobs in Canada.

5. Canada vs India: HealthCare

In the 2022 World Health Statistics Report of WHO (World Health Organization), Canada ranks higher than India because Canada has a better healthcare system and is easily accessible. Canadian Medicare is universal and decentralised. Here, health insurance is funded by the Canadian government, ensuring free service in hospitals. Permanent resident holders can benefit from Medicare and gain financial coverage for prescribed medicines. 

On that side, India is popular for medical tourism, especially traditional medicines like Ayurveda, Siddha, Yoga, Neuropathy and Homeopathy. Even though India has more hospitals, clinics, doctors & nurses than Canada, they fall behind due to a lack of health infrastructure, a larger population, poor access to remote areas, no insurance coverage, etc.

Astonishingly, during the Covid-19 pandemic, India was among the least affected due to timely preventive measures by the public & private sectors and vaccinating citizens.

6. Canada vs India: Safety and Crime Rate

In terms of Safety and Crime Rate, Canada registered less crime than India. In the 2022 Global Peace Index (GPI), Canada ranks 12th, and India ranks 135th position. It reveals that Canada is a safer and more peaceful place to live. 

The Global Peace Index produced by the Institute for Economics and Peace (IEP), determines the state of peace across three different factors:

  • The level of Societal Safety and Security
  • The extent of Ongoing Domestic and International Conflict
  • And the degree of Militarisation

Recently, an Indian student who works at a departmental store in Ontario said, “This is a friendly country. At 20, I have a job here. Canada makes me feel independent and confident, and I am happy to be here.” Similarly, another student said, “This is such a peaceful country with fun-loving and helpful people.”

7. Canada vs India: Climate and Weather Conditions

India is a relatively warm country, suitable for living. But Canada is one of the coldest countries in the world, with very short summers and more freezing winters. The average temperature of India recorded 26.03 degrees Celsius as it’s located in the tropical zone, while Canada’s average temperature was 2.1 °C (35.78 °F) as it’s in the temperate zone.  

When Indians move to Canada, they must be aware of extremely cold weather, strokes, infectious diseases due to climate change, endemic, etc. As far as pollution is concerned, Canada absorbs clean air and water. And India is suffering from air pollution in the northern parts. 

Canada vs India: Which is better?

By comparing Canada vs India, you would know that Canada promises a better standard of living, highly-paid jobs for skilled workers, a safe place to live, free healthcare services, and lots more. While India is striving to achieve the best safety standards, health insurance for all, necessary infrastructure, quality education, etc.

Based on the above factors, it is clear that Canada is better than India for study, work or migration purposes, thus attracting millions of immigrants across the globe every year. 


1. Which is better, living in Canada or India?

Canada is better than India in living because Canada has a better standard of living, high-salaried jobs, a low crime rate, free healthcare services, public infrastructure, quality education, etc. And as per the 2022 Human Development Index (HDI), Canada is 15th, and India is in the 132nd position.

2. Is Canada richer than India?

Yes. Canada is richer than India. The GDP per capita of Canada is $46,150, whereas GDP per capita of India is $6,125 as of 2020. 

3. Is Canada good for Indians?

Absolutely, Canada is good for Indians. Many Indians have moved to Canada in the recent past for study or better job opportunities. Canada also offers permanent residence (PR) for international students who meet the eligibility criteria.

4. Why do people choose Canada over India?

Since Canada has a better standard of living and more purchasing power than India, people choose Canada over India. Moreover, Canada provides a better education, healthcare, a safer place to live, and, more importantly, job opportunities.

5. How much is a good salary in Canada?

A good salary in Canada is CAD 45,855 per year, which is $3,821 per month or $14.1 per hour.

Subscribe and get our weekly updates straight in your inbox.

Recent posts from Roshan Sunthar


Roshan Sunthar

GRE Requirement for MS in Canada

gre requirement for ms in canada

Roshan Sunthar

Web Developer Salary in Canada


Roshan Sunthar

SOP For International Business Management


Roshan Sunthar

What is GRE Quantitative Reasoning?

what is gre quantitative reasoning

Roshan Sunthar

Retaking the GRE

retaking the gre

Roshan Sunthar

CA Salary In Canada


A truly global higher education partner to learners and education institutions Support learners at every point in their global education journey with reliable services, products and solutions.

Global Headquarters

Kanan Int EdTech Inc

229, Yonge Street Suite 406 Toronto Ontario, Canada M5B 1N9

Indian Headquarters

Kanan International Pvt. Ltd.

D-wing, 2nd Floor, Trident Complex, Ellora Park Vadiwadi Road, Vadodara, Gujarat 390007

IT/ Digital Campus

Chennai Office

132, Habibullah Rd, Satyamurthy Nagar, T. Nagar, Chennai, Tamil Nadu 600017

kanan-ftr-phone+91 63570 12000


Copyright © 2023 KANAN.CO All rights reserved.